the hague - The appeal in the 'less-Moroccans process' PVV leader Geert Wilders begins in late October. On 24 and 26 October are scheduled hearings are called. Then can be done from either side research needs. On November 9 the court in The Hague takes the decisions about needs and requests. When the trial is scheduled, is not yet clear.

The court ruled last year that Wilders on March 19, 2014 had been guilty during a party meeting televised on inciting discrimination and insulting a group, but he was no penalty. PVV supporters chanted on the question of whether Wilders had been more or less Moroccans in the Netherlands; ' less, less, less. '' The prosecution had demanded a fine of 5,000 euros.

Both Wilders and the prosecution appealed the verdict. The Court holds, as during the trial of first instance, sitting at the high-security location at Schiphol.
